The Role of Horizontal Balers in Waste Handling


Efficient waste handling is an increasing priority for organisations managing large volumes of more info recyclable materials. A get more info horizontal waste baler is used to compact waste like paper, plastics, and cardboard into tightly formed bundles. Unlike vertical balers, horizontal balers operate with horizontal feeding, making them suitable for continuous or high-capacity operations.



The structure of a horizontal baler machine supports smooth material handling. Materials can often be introduced via conveyors, which reduces manual handling and helps maintain consistent workflows. This makes them a suitable option for businesses aiming to improve waste management while maintaining productivity.



Key Features of Horizontal Baler Machines


One of the main advantages of horizontal balers is their ability to handle waste without interruption. This is particularly beneficial in facilities where waste is generated throughout the day, such as distribution centres and manufacturing plants.



Horizontal baler machines are built for high-volume performance. Their design allows consistent processing without regular pauses, helping to keep operations running smoothly.



Many models include automated systems such as automatic tying functions and adjustable settings. These limit operator involvement and ensure uniform bale formation. Although horizontal balers take up more room than vertical units, they are ideal for spacious sites. Their layout often integrates with conveyor systems for improved efficiency.



Common Uses for Horizontal Balers


Horizontal balers are used across a wide range of industries that produce significant amounts of recyclable waste:




  • Retail warehouses and logistics hubs generate substantial cardboard waste, which can be easily baled and managed.

  • Industrial facilities generate a range of waste types, including plastics and paper.

  • Recycling facilities rely on horizontal balers to prepare materials for transport.

  • Waste collection and sorting operations benefit from reduced material volume, helping to reduce logistics expenses.



Advantages of Horizontal Baling Systems



  • Dense bales take up less space and lowers collection frequency.

  • Lower handling and transport needs contribute to savings.

  • Automation helps minimise downtime and improves operational efficiency.

  • Consistent bale output makes storage and handling easier.

  • Reducing loose waste improves workplace safety, while automation limits manual handling risks.



Choosing the Right Horizontal Baler


Choosing the appropriate baler involves assessing site needs, including:




  • Waste volume: Align capacity with expected volumes.

  • Type of recyclables: Different materials require suitable compression levels.

  • System functionality: Automated systems are beneficial for high-output environments.

  • Integration with existing systems: Ensure smooth integration with current operations.



A well-chosen horizontal baler supports long-term efficiency without introducing unnecessary complexity.



Ongoing Maintenance and Operation


Routine maintenance is essential for reliable operation. Inspecting hydraulic systems, cutting components, and tying mechanisms can reduce the risk of downtime.



Staff training is necessary to ensure correct handling. This includes understanding loading procedures, monitoring bale formation, and identifying issues early.



FAQs About Horizontal Balers



What materials can a horizontal baler process?

Horizontal balers typically process cardboard, paper, plastics, and some textiles.



How does a horizontal baler differ from a vertical baler?

They support ongoing, large-scale operations, while vertical balers are better suited to smaller workloads.



Are horizontal balers fully automated?

Some models include automation features such as auto-tying and conveyor feeding, while others may require partial manual input.



Which industries benefit most from horizontal balers?

Industries such as retail, logistics, manufacturing, and recycling frequently rely on these machines.



Do horizontal balers require a large installation area?

They generally require more space than vertical balers, making them ideal for spacious environments.
